A HostLive WFO and Content Creator typically involves a mix of hosting live events (like streams, webinars, or online shows) and creating content across various platforms (like YouTube, Instagram, TikTok, etc.). Here’s an overview of the job scope:
1. HostLive Responsibilities:
- Live Streaming/Hosting: You’re responsible for engaging and interacting with audiences during live events, whether it's a product launch, Q&A session, live tutorial, or entertainment show.
- Audience Engagement: Responding to comments, answering questions, and keeping the audience entertained in real-time. This could involve chats, polls, and shout-outs.
- Event Planning: Organizing and planning live events, ensuring everything runs smoothly before and during the live session (e.g., setting up tech, guest coordination, etc.).
- Brand Representation: If you’re hosting for a brand or organization, you represent their voice, maintaining a positive and professional image while being authentic and relatable.
- Technical Aspects: Handling technical setups like cameras, microphones, streaming software, and ensuring the live stream runs without glitches.
2. Content Creator Responsibilities:
- Content Production: Creating and editing content for social media or other platforms, such as videos, photos, blogs, and podcasts. This might involve brainstorming ideas, scripting, shooting, editing, and posting.
- Branding and Marketing: Ensuring that content is aligned with personal or brand values, engaging your target audience, and promoting content through cross-platform strategies (e.g., Instagram Stories, YouTube videos, TikTok clips).
- Consistency and Frequency: Posting regularly and maintaining a content calendar to ensure there’s always fresh content going out to your audience.
- Collaboration: Collaborating with other influencers, brands, or content creators for cross-promotion or guest features. This helps to expand your reach and engagement.
- Analytics: Tracking metrics to assess the performance of your content and live events, adjusting strategies to increase views, engagement, and follower growth.
Key Skills for Success:
- Communication: Strong verbal and written communication skills to engage audiences and convey information clearly.
- Creativity: Developing new, engaging ideas for content and live shows to keep your audience interested.
- Technical Proficiency: Familiarity with streaming platforms (Twitch, YouTube Live, Facebook Live), editing software (Adobe Premiere, Final Cut Pro), and content creation tools (e.g., Canva, Photoshop).
- Time Management: Balancing live events with content creation and posting schedules.
- Marketing Knowledge: Understanding of SEO, social media algorithms, and digital marketing to optimize content and reach.
Potential Challenges:
- Time-Intensive: Managing both hosting live events and content creation can be time-consuming and requires consistency.
- Pressure to Perform: Live events may come with the pressure of maintaining energy and engagement for extended periods.
- Monetization: Finding ways to monetize content and live hosting can require significant audience growth and strategic partnerships.
